KEY INFRASTRUCTURE CHALLENGES

Operational Challenges Across the Distributed Edge

Edge data centers extend critical infrastructure across smaller, remotely managed locations. Without consistent data and centralized visibility, operational teams may struggle to maintain accurate records, coordinate changes, and make informed capacity or availability decisions.

Fragmented Multi-Site Visibility

Separate monitoring tools, analytics systems, and databases can prevent teams from obtaining a consistent view of infrastructure health across central and edge locations.

Remote Change Coordination

Technicians working at remote facilities require accurate instructions and infrastructure records. Incomplete information can contribute to incorrect work orders or improperly executed changes.

Asset and Connection Accuracy

Distributed deployments make it difficult to maintain reliable records of equipment, rack placement, power relationships, and network connections across every edge location.

Capacity Constraints

Edge facilities place data center components into smaller footprints, increasing the importance of understanding available space, power, cooling, and connectivity capacity before changes are approved.

Infrastructure Health Monitoring

Mission-critical edge applications depend on the health of supporting facilities. Teams need centralized insight into power, cooling, assets, and related infrastructure conditions.

Inconsistent Operational Decisions

Inaccurate data spread across disconnected systems can undermine planning, change management, and decisions affecting availability, uptime, and future infrastructure requirements.

Use cases

Edge Computing Use Cases

By placing processing, storage, and cached content closer to users and devices, edge data centers support applications that depend on low latency, local data handling, rapid analysis, or high-bandwidth delivery.

Autonomous and Connected Transportation

Local collection, processing, and sharing of vehicle data can support faster responses and safer autonomous transportation operations.

Smart Cities and Infrastructure

Real-time analysis of traffic, utility, and infrastructure data can help public authorities identify conditions and respond to issues more quickly.

Industrial IoT and Manufacturing

Local storage and computing for industrial IoT devices can support predictive maintenance and improved energy efficiency within manufacturing environments.

Latency-Sensitive Financial Services

Reducing latency can help high-volume financial organizations execute trading algorithms more quickly by moving processing resources closer to relevant activity.

Telemedicine and Patient Data

Healthcare providers can gain more immediate access to critical information collected by personal health-monitoring devices and fitness wearables.

Retail Augmented Reality

Edge processing can support the real-time data requirements of augmented-reality experiences used to create more immersive interactions in retail stores.

Local Video Processing

Video from cameras using motion detection or facial tracking can be collected and processed locally, reducing the need to transport every data stream to a central facility.

Gaming and Content Delivery

Local processing, matchmaking, and cached content can support low-latency multiplayer gaming and faster delivery of digital content to end users.

What is an edge data center?

An edge data center is a smaller facility located close to the population, users, or devices it serves. It provides local computing resources or cached content and typically connects to a larger central data center or a network of data centers.

How does edge computing reduce latency?

Edge computing processes data and delivers services closer to the end user or originating device. Reducing the distance data must travel can improve response times and support applications that require real-time or near-real-time processing.

What makes edge data centers difficult to manage?

Edge facilities are distributed, compact, remotely managed, and often mission critical. Teams must coordinate technicians while maintaining accurate visibility into infrastructure health, assets, capacity, power, cooling, security, and connectivity across many locations.
